Re: Windows nie widzi PenDrive

Autor: Michal Kawecki <kkwinto_at_o2.px>
Data: Sun 14 Jan 2007 - 09:14:38 MET
Message-ID: <70pcoe.fdb.ln@kwinto.prv>
Content-Type: text/plain; format=flowed; charset="utf-8"; reply-type=response

"Michal Biek" <mb@2.pl.invalid> wrote in message
news:eoc444$of5$1@opal.icpnet.pl...
> Michal Kawecki log:
>> "Michal Biek" <mb@2.pl.invalid> wrote in message
>> news:eobui1$gje$1@opal.icpnet.pl...
>>> Michal Kawecki log:
>>> [...]
>>>> Niekoniecznie. Tak się stanie gdy nowy pen będzie miał taki sam
>>>> HW_ID jak poprzedni.
>>> IMHO niemozliwe! Łatwo to sprawdzić podłączjąc je obydwa!:-)
>>> BTW obcy, nowy nie dostanie/nie stworzy HW_ID takiego samego.
>> Zaraz zaraz. Hardware ID nie jest generowane przez system, tylko
>> przydzielane konkretnemu urządzeniu po zarejestrowaniu go w FCC.
>> Zakładam teraz całkiem prawdopodobną sytuację, że dane urządzenie ma
>> taki sam identyfikator HW_ID jak inne, a ponadto nie ma własnego
>> serial number - co jest nader częste właśnie w przypadku USB Penów.
>> Jeśli taki pen zostanie wetknięty w to samo gniazdo co poprzedni pen
>> o tym samym HW_ID, to jak niby system miałby je rozróżnić?
>
> Serial/ID urządzenia zawsze jest.

Mylisz się, Michale. Przeczytaj ten wątek chociażby:
http://blogs.msdn.com/oldnewthing/archive/2004/11/10/255047.aspx
Komentarze są dość interesujące także.

> Jedynie może nie być rozpoznany właściwie przez OS, w co wątpię (, bo
> szereg wad zostało dotychczas naprawione oficjalnie lub nieoficjalnie
> przez fixy WU). IMHO gdyby "Jeśli taki pen zostanie wetknięty w to
> samo gniazdo co poprzedni pen o tym samym HW_ID, to jak niby system
> miałby je rozróżnić?" to albo oficjalny siakiś konflikt albo
> standardowa reakcja systemu. Bo faktycznie co system obchodzi co mu
> wetkniesz za USB pen? Wetknąłeś mu pena, a on ma go albo
> ujawnić/pozwolić na podmontowanie albo pokazać, że coś nie tak! Jeżeli
> to jest mylne to poproszę o wyprostowanie ...!:-)

Już wyjaśniam. System znajdzie owszem wetknięte urządzenie, ale może je
nieprawidłowo rozpoznać z uwagi na to, że pomyli je z wcześniej
rozpoznanym urządzeniem. Zajrzyj do klucza
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\USBSTOR, a sam
zobaczysz że każde rozpoznane urządzenie USB może mieć przydzielonych
szereg specyficznych jedynie dla niego parametrów. W przypadku
podejrzenia jakichś konfliktów najlepiej byłoby więc ten klucz wyczyścić
i potem dopiero próbować wpinać nowe urządzenia.

-- 
M.   [MS-MVP]
/odpowiadając na priv zmień px na pl/ 
Received on Sun Jan 14 09:25:06 2007

To archiwum zostao wygenerowane przez hypermail 2.1.8 : Sun 14 Jan 2007 - 09:42:02 MET